- This is the first part of my 3-part-video about the creation of a large format abstract painting. In this video I show the first steps of the painting process of my acrylic painting “Raspberries kissed my Gin Tonic”. My way of working makes it clear how the image builds up layer by layer and sometimes it is necessary to weaken parts that I have grown fond of so that others can become more dominant. I painted on a canvas that is not yet stretched on a stretcher frame. It will then be sent rolled up. The work measures 214 cm x 140 cm.

My name is Kirsten Handelmann, I am a freelance artist and qualified graphic designer from Hanover in Germany. My great passion is abstract painting.
In my videos I would like to give you insights into my work processes, i.e. applying layers of paint, assessing them and painting over them again. I would also like to introduce you to some of my finished works and also show you small scenes from my daily artistic work, such as preparing a work for shipping when it has been sold.
But what I also want to document is that not everything always leads to satisfactory results straight away. It can be a long process with many detours until the work is finished for me, and sometimes it is better to put the work away for now.
I usually work on several paintings at the same time, which I repeatedly bring out and re-evaluate. Often, with a little distance, I can immediately see what they need.
I only use acrylic paints and very consciously use the interplay of the different transparencies.
